Here's What Investors Must Know Ahead of Fluor's Q2 Earnings Release
ZACKS· 2025-07-31 16:11
Core Viewpoint - Fluor Corporation (FLR) is set to report its second-quarter 2025 results on August 1, with expectations of revenue growth driven by strong demand in various sectors, despite a projected decline in earnings per share [1][3][9]. Financial Performance - In the last reported quarter, Fluor's adjusted earnings per share (EPS) exceeded the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 46%, while revenues fell short by 6.3%. Year-over-year, EPS grew by 55.3% and revenues by 7% [1]. - The Zacks Consensus Estimate for the second-quarter EPS is unchanged at 59 cents, reflecting a 30.6% decline from 85 cents a year ago. Revenue estimates are at $4.82 billion, indicating a 13.9% increase from $4.23 billion in the previous year [3]. Revenue Drivers - The anticipated revenue growth is attributed to robust demand for infrastructure projects in sectors such as data centers, semiconductors, pharmaceuticals, energy transition, fuel production, and mining and metals. Additionally, strength in environmental remediation and national security is expected to contribute positively [4]. - The Urban Solutions segment is projected to generate revenues of $2.47 billion, a 35% increase from $1.83 billion a year ago. The Mission Solutions segment is expected to see revenues of $718 million, reflecting a 2% growth. Conversely, the Energy Solutions segment is estimated to decline by 4.4% to $1.53 billion from $1.6 billion [6]. Earnings Outlook - Fluor's bottom line is expected to decline year-over-year due to unfavorable currency translation, tariff-related uncertainties, and inflationary pressures. Challenges from commodity price volatility and the cyclical nature of its business lines are also anticipated to impact profitability [8]. - The projected segment profits for Urban, Energy, and Mission Solutions are expected to decline year-over-year, with estimates of $79 million, $61 million, and $36 million, respectively, compared to $105 million, $75 million, and $41 million in the previous year [10]. Earnings Prediction Model - The current model does not predict an earnings beat for Fluor, as the company has an Earnings ESP of 0.00% and a Zacks Rank of 3 (Hold) [11][12].

Parsons Wins ACEC New York Diamond Award for Brooklyn Bridge Rehabilitation Project
Globenewswire· 2025-07-17 10:25
Core Insights - Parsons Corporation has been awarded the Diamond Award in the Structural Systems category by the American Council of Engineering Companies of New York for its role as the prime design consultant on the Brooklyn Bridge Rehabilitation Project, highlighting the project's innovation and public benefit [1][4] - The Brooklyn Bridge Rehabilitation Project, valued at $300 million, involved the restoration and modernization of the bridge's towers and approaches while preserving its historic character and enhancing structural integrity and safety [2][3] Company Achievements - The project has received both statewide and national recognition, advancing to the national level of ACEC's Engineering Excellence Awards, marking a significant achievement for the New York City Department of Transportation [4] - Parsons has a long history of contributing to the infrastructure of the New York and New Jersey region, with over 100 years of experience in delivering complex and resilient solutions [5] Future Commitment - The company is dedicated to addressing evolving infrastructure demands in the NY/NJ region by providing sustainable and forward-looking solutions that enhance quality of life and protect regional heritage [6] - Parsons has extensive experience in various infrastructure sectors, including roads, bridges, rail, public transit, and airports, contributing to improved safety and travel efficiency [7]
KBR Awarded FEED Contract for KEPPT's Fertilizer Facility in Iraq
Globenewswire· 2025-07-16 10:00
Core Insights - KBR has been awarded a front-end engineering design (FEED) contract for an ammonia and urea production plant in Basra, Iraq [1][2] - The facility will produce 2,300 metric tons per day (MTPD) of ammonia and 3,850 MTPD of urea, utilizing KBR's proprietary ammonia technology [2] - The project aims to enhance Iraq's agricultural industry, create jobs, and reduce fertilizer imports, positioning Iraq as a global ammonia producer [3] Company Overview - KBR provides science, technology, and engineering solutions globally, employing approximately 38,000 people and serving customers in over 80 countries [4] - The company has extensive experience, having been involved in the licensing, design, engineering, and construction of more than 260 ammonia plants worldwide [3][4]

Parsons Celebrates Infrastructure Excellence in Missouri with Award on I-270 Project
Globenewswire· 2025-07-10 10:25
Core Insights - Parsons Corporation has been recognized with the Engineering Excellence Award for its role as lead designer in the I-270 North Design-Build Project, highlighting its significance in innovative infrastructure development [1][2]. Project Overview - The I-270 North Design-Build Project has a total construction value of $252 million and is the largest project undertaken by the Missouri Department of Transportation in recent years [2]. - The project spans nine miles and includes the rehabilitation and widening of I-270, along with the reconstruction of ten interchanges [2]. - Innovative design solutions such as one-way roadways and modern roundabouts were implemented to enhance safety and reduce congestion [2]. Impact and Benefits - The project eliminated unsignalized, at-grade crossovers and constructed 18 new bridges, significantly improving regional traffic flow and safety [3]. - It delivered maximum value within a fixed-price design-build contract, benefiting motorists and enhancing economic access across a heavily traveled corridor in Missouri [3]. - The project is seen as a commitment to improving transportation infrastructure that supports safety, mobility, and economic growth [3][4]. Company Expertise - Parsons has extensive experience in designing and delivering infrastructure projects, including over 10,000 miles of roadways and 4,500 bridges [5]. - The company focuses on improving safety and travel efficiency while reducing emissions and energy costs, thereby enhancing the quality of life in the communities served [5].
